My first Magazine pemrograman-kompetitif-dasar | Page 28
2 Matematika Diskret Dasar
Apabila kita hitung satu per satu, maka cara yang berbeda untuk menuju kota C dari kota A
adalah sebagai berikut:
•
•
•
•
•
•
Melalui jalur e 1
Melalui jalur e 1
Melalui jalur e 2
Melalui jalur e 2
Melalui jalur e 3
Melalui jalur e 3
kemudian jalur e 4 .
kemudian jalur e 5 .
kemudian jalur e 4 .
kemudian jalur e 5 .
kemudian jalur e 4 .
kemudian jalur e 5 .
Dengan kata lain, terdapat 6 cara berbeda untuk menuju kota C dari kota A. Namun, apabila
jumlah kota dan jalur yang ada sangatlah banyak, kita tidak mungkin menulis satu per satu cara
yang berbeda. Karena itulah kita dapat menggunakan aturan perkalian.
Misalkan suatu proses dapat dibagi menjadi N subproses independen yang mana terdapat a i
cara untuk menyelesaikan subproses ke-i. Menurut aturan perkalian, banyak cara yang berbeda
untuk menyelesaikan proses tersebut adalah a 1 × a 2 × a 3 × ... × a N .
Kita akan mencoba mencari banyaknya cara menuju kota C dari kota A menggunakan aturan
perkalian. Anggaplah bahwa:
• Perjalanan dari kota A menuju kota B merupakan subproses pertama, yang mana terdapat
3 cara untuk menyelesaikan subproses tersebut.
• Perjalanan dari kota B menuju kota C merupakan subproses kedua, yang mana terdapat 2
cara untuk menyelesaikan subproses tersebut.
Karena perjalanan dari kota A menuju kota B dan dari kota B menuju kota C merupakan 2
subproses yang berbeda, maka kita dapat menggunakan aturan perkalian. Banyak cara berbeda
dari kota A menuju kota C adalah 3 × 2 = 6.
Contoh Soal 2.3: Kota 2
Contoh soal ini merupakan lanjutan dari Kota 1.
Deskripsi soal, jumlah kota dan jalur serta susunan jalur yang ada sama persis dengan soal
tersebut.
Tambahkan 1 jalur lagi, yaitu e 6 yang menghubungkan kota A dan C. Berapa banyak cara
berbeda untuk menuju kota C dari kota A?
e 4
e 1
A
e 2
e 3
B
e 5
C
e 6
Dengan mencoba satu per satu setiap cara, maka terdapat 7 cara yang berbeda, yaitu 6 cara
sesuai dengan soal sebelumnya, ditambah dengan menggunakan jalur e 6 .
Apabila kita menggunakan aturan perkalian, maka didapatkan banyak cara yang berbeda
adalah 3 × 2 × 1 = 6 yang mana jawaban tersebut tidaklah tepat. Kita tidak dapat menggunakan
18